WebStrongylocentrotus droebachiensis acquire their common name, "green sea urchin" from the green outer shell. All sea urchins have an exoskeleton made of calcitic plates rooted into their skin. The solid exoskeleton, or the test, is composed of several plates that are tightly bound together.

WebThe Spiny Sea Urchin has long, needle-like spines, which it wedges in cracks and crevices to secure itself to rocks. Identification. The spines of the Spiny Sea Urchin may have a green iridescence, while the test (body) varies in colour from deep red to black. Habitat.
